Nikki Haley Emerges As Final Challenger To Donald Trump

It seems clear that former South Carolina Governor and United Nations Ambassador Nikki Haley is the sole final challenger to Donald Trump for the Republican Presidential nomination in 2024.

She has moved up in polls in Iowa and New Hampshire, while Florida Governor Ron DeSantis is faltering.

If former New Jersey Governor Chris Christie were to drop out in New Hampshire, it would give Haley a fighting chance, in theory, to catch up to Trump.

The problem, however, is that Haley has been unwilling to directly challenge Trump, and some observers think she is angling for the Vice Presidential nomination with Trump.

Ultimately, the primary in South Carolina, Haley’s home state, will be the crucial factor in Haley’s candidacy, as if she cannot win there, then the nomination clearly is in the hands of Donald Trump.

Only One Republican Senator And Many Republican Governors In Presidential Race Of 2024!

With the Presidential Election campaign beginning with the announcement of numerous Republicans having declared their candidacy or about to announce, an odd point to make is that ONLY one Republican Senator, Tim Scott of South Carolina, has announced his candidacy, and it is highly unlikely any other Republican Senators will join the fray.

Instead, the bulk of candidates are those who have served as Governors in the past or the present.

This includes Ron DeSantis (Florida), Nikki Haley (South Carolina), Mike Pence (Indiana), Asa Hutchinson (Arkansas), Doug Burgum (North Dakota), Kristi Noem (South Dakota), Chris Christie (New Jersey), Chris Sununu (New Hampshire), Glenn Youngkin (Virginia), and Greg Abbott (Texas).

In 2016, the following US Senators ran for the Republican Presidential nomination: Ted Cruz (Texas), Marco Rubio (Florida), Rand Paul (Kentucky), Rick Santorum (Pennsylvania), and Lindsey Graham (South Carolina). All except Santorum are still in the Senate, but not choosing to run this cycle!

There are also other Republican Senators rumored to have Presidential ambitions, including Rick Scott (Florida), Josh Hawley (Missouri), and Tom Cotton (Arkansas), but they have chosen to stay out of the race.
